  1. circumincession love

Definitions

Century Dictionary and Cyclopedia

  1. n. In theology, the reciprocal existence in one another of the three persons in the Godhead.

Wiktionary

  1. n. theology The reciprocal existence in each other of the three persons of the Trinity.

GNU Webster's 1913

  1. n. (Theol.) The reciprocal existence in each other of the three persons of the Trinity.

Etymologies

  1. circum- + Latin incedere, incessum, to walk. (Wiktionary)

Examples

  • “Lastly, this is to be especially considered -- that this circumincession of the Divine Persons is indeed a very great mystery, which we ought rather religiously to adore than curiously to pry into.”

    NPNF2-09. Hilary of Poitiers, John of Damascus

  • “This outcome of the circumincession of the Persons in the Trinity is so far from introducing Sabellianism, that it is of great use, as Petavius has also observed, for (establishing) the diversity of the Persons, and for confuting that heresy.”

    NPNF2-09. Hilary of Poitiers, John of Damascus
